Kraft Foods Inc. to Join the NASDAQ-100 Index Beginning July 23, 2012
Date 14/07/2012
Kraft Foods Inc. (Nasdaq:KFT) will become a component of the NASDAQ-100 Index® (Nasdaq:NDX), the NASDAQ-100 Equal Weighted Index (Nasdaq:NDXE) and the NASDAQ-100 Ex-Tech Sector Index prior to market open on Monday, July 23, 2012. Kraft Foods Inc. will replace Ctrip.com International, Ltd. (Nasdaq:CTRP).

CFTC’s Division Of Swap Dealer And Intermediary Oversight Issues Time-Limited No-Action Relief To Certain CPOs And CTAs to Meet Registration And Compliance Obligations - Entities have Until December, 31, 2012, to Comply with Changes to Part 4 of the Commission’s Regulations Involving Registration and Compliance Obligations for CPOs and CTAs
Date 13/07/2012
The Commodity Futures Trading Commission’s (CFTC) Division of Swap Dealer and Intermediary Oversight (DSIO) today announced the issuance of time-limited no-action relief for commodity pool operators (CPOs) and commodity trading advisors (CTAs) who have been exempt or excluded from registration but, because of recent amendments to Commission Regulations 4.13 and 4.5, now need to register and satisfy compliance obligations.

New York Fed Responds To Congressional Request For Information On Barclays LIBOR Matter - Documents
Date 13/07/2012
Attached are materials related to the actions of the Federal Reserve Bank of New York (“New York Fed”) in connection with the Barclays-LIBOR matter. These include documents requested by Chairman Neugebauer of the U.S. House of Representatives, Committee on Financial Services, Subcommittee on Oversight and Investigations. Chairman Neugebauer requested all transcripts that relate to communications with Barclays regarding the setting of interbank offered rates from August 2007 to November 2009. Please note that the transcript of conversations between the New York Fed and Barclays was provided by Barclays pursuant to recent regulatory actions, and the New York Fed cannot attest to the accuracy of these records. The packet also includes additional materials that document our efforts in 2008 to highlight problems with LIBOR and press for reform. We will continue to review our records and actions and will provide updated information as warranted.

CFTC Approves New Financial Rules Submitted By The National Futures Association To Strengthen The Protection Of Customer Funds Held By Futures Commission Merchants
Date 13/07/2012
The Commodity Futures Trading Commission (Commission or CFTC) today approved new financial rules submitted by the National Futures Association (NFA) that enhance protections to customer funds held by futures commission merchants (FCMs). The new financial rules are set forth in NFA Financial Requirements Section 16, and an Interpretive Notice entitled “NFA Financial Requirements Section 16 FCM Financial Practices and Excess Segregated Funds/Secured Amount Disbursements.”
